Output 8395cc366cffbdec6e20ffa0e86741e7d2cd4d9da75fc25a4c72d07ce61144d9:1

value
1057035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e01315431996475a5269d67addd4c393eb314e8 OP_EQUAL
address
3Qr4z8yVeqxwR7dos5EwMzVHGfeXpbQqB6
transaction
8395cc366cffbdec6e20ffa0e86741e7d2cd4d9da75fc25a4c72d07ce61144d9
spent
true